Which of the following is not associated with the British Rule in India? |
Secularisation Modernisation Sanskritization Both 1 and 3 |
Sanskritization |
The correct answer is option 3: Sanskritization Option 1: Secularisation Incorrect. Secularisation is associated with the changes brought about by colonial rule. It is one of the processes that can be understood as a response to colonialism. Option 2: Modernisation Incorrect. Modernisation is also associated with the changes introduced during the colonial period. It emerged as a response to the structural and cultural transformations brought about by colonial rule. Option 3: Sanskritisation Correct. Sanskritisation pre-dates the coming of colonial rule. It is not associated with the changes introduced by British rule, unlike modernisation, secularisation and westernisation. |
